The first Deputy speaker stresses the need to take measures to address the inflation

upload_1665321206_1002913061.jpeg
 Economy
 
+A -A

Baghdad-INA

The First Deputy Speaker of the parliament , Mohsen Al-Mandalawi, stressed on Sunday, the need to take measures to address the inflation caused by the devaluation of the dinar against the dollar.

Al-Mandalawi said in a statement issued while chairing an expanded meeting of the Finance Committee in the presence of Central Bank Governor Mustafa Ghaleb, and received by the Iraqi News Agency (INA), that "the Central Bank Iraq (CBI) is directly responsible for implementing the country's banking policies, and it is concerned with developing the work of banks and monitoring their business with the aim of protecting deposits Citizens and keeping pace with the global development in this important sector on which the state depends to develop the rest of the sectors such as industry, agriculture, investment, tourism and others,” stressing that “the bank must take  measures to address the inflation caused by the devaluation of the dinar against the dollar."

The statement added, "CBI has a period of one week to answer clearly the questions submitted by the members of the Finance Committee, and to provide the Committee with all documents related to the file of letters of guarantee and the currency sale window."

During the meeting, a number of questions were raised by the members of the Finance Committee related to the currency sale window of the CBI, the industrial and housing initiative loans, the CBI policies regarding increasing the capital of commercial, Islamic and private banks, custodian banks, letters of guarantee, and the bank’s supervisory role over banks, and to come up with a number of recommendations ,and it was agreed to hold another meeting soon to answer the questions raised and to provide a full briefing on all topics and details.
